Question 656306: Please help me solve this question: during the 2009 major league baseball season, the los angeles dogers played 162 games. They won 28 more games than they lost. What was their win-loss record that year?
Answer by Alan3354(69443) (Show Source): You can put this solution on YOUR website!
during the 2009 major league baseball season, the los angeles dogers played 162 games. They won 28 more games than they lost. What was their win-loss record that year?
-----------------
W + L = 162
W = L + 28
-------------
Can you do the rest?
